What are the key differences between qualitative and quantitative research?
Quantitative and qualitative research approaches are all applied when collecting and
analyzing the data. The quantitative approach is usually used by researchers who employ survey
methods while the qualitative approach is based on understanding something from a closer
perspective. Quantitative research is based on the need to explain a certain occurrence or trends
while quantitative research depends on the opinion of the respondents in the survey, opinions as
well as polls (Punch, 2013). Moreover, quantitative research entails asking narrow or specific
questions in order to obtain observable and measurable data on the variables. On the other hand,
qualitative research is based on the exploration method and employed to help understand
opinions, motivations, and reasons for other people.
The other difference in the qualitative and quantitative research approaches lies in the
research problem section. Quantitative questions are used to direct hypotheses or type of
questions asked in the quantitative study. However, in the qualitative research problem helps to
determine the importance of the central idea. In addition, qualitative research approach uses
open-ended approaches when interviewing the participants whereas quantitative research
approach uses closed-ended approaches when collecting data. Quantitative research uses
mathematical calculations and numbers while the qualitative research is based upon oral or
written things from an observation or an individual.
